Bright Accent - Bridge on Myasishchev Street Will Be Painted Red

05 December 2022

The automobile bridge in the alignment of Myasishchev Street will connect Khoroshyovo-Mnevniki District and Filyovskaya Poyma Microdistrict. The bridge will be about 350 meters long, and have a distinctive feature - structures painted in a bright red color. Earlier, Moscow Committee for Architecture prepared architectural concepts for seven bridges that could become new symbols of the city. This was announced by Chief Architect of Moscow Sergey Kuznetsov.

 “The river along Myasishchev Street is navigable, which is reflected in the shape and dimensions of the bridge. In addition, the proximity of another bridge in the shape of a sail, which is planned to be built along Novozavodskaya Street, had the influence. The proposed engineering structure is designed to support and link them with a common idea. According to Moscow Mayor Sergei Sobyanin, seven new bridges will be built across the Moskva River, four of them will appear in the Khoroshyovo-Mnevniki area,” Sergei Kuznetsov said.

Metal box beams are attached to the pylons and take the load of the main span. The shape of these structures resembles the rigging of a ship, which creates a bright, memorable silhouette in the current environment and evening landscapes on both sides of the Moskva River.

The total height of the structure at the pylon installation sites will be about 25 meters from the water level. At the same time, the width of the main span across the river will be about 120 meters, and the height of the underbridge clearance will be 11 meters, which will allow navigation and movement of water transport. The project was developed by Leonhardt, Andra und Partners (Germany) and TPO PRIDE, technical support and consultations were provided by Intermost OOO.

The bridge in the alignment of Myasishchev Street will be painted with several layers of durable paints. The color of the spans will be light gray, and the side parts, together with the pylons, are supposed to be painted in red. “It will certainly add bright accents to the engineering structure, and make the image of the bridge more recognizable. The expected frequency of maintenance is twice a year,” said Oleg Ivanov, technical director of TPO PRIDE.

“This bridge will not be the only one painted in red, the color is also supposed to be used for the other three bridges under construction on the Mnyovnikovskaya floodplain, further strengthening and uniting the development of adjacent territories with a common concept,” Kuznetsov explained.

The traffic is going to move in four lanes. On one side of the roadway of the bridge, a safe pedestrian zone 3.1 meters wide will be organized, which will also be used by people with special needs. On the other side of the roadway, a combined bicycle-pedestrian section 6.25 meters wide will be made.

 “Despite the fact that the bridge is considered to be automobile, it will be as comfortable as possible for pedestrians. On the way to the metro, to the new Mnyovniki station, people will be able to admire the river from observation platforms provided on both sides of the road at the locations of the pylons. And the allocated lane for cycling will have a positive impact on the formation and development of a unified system of cycling routes in the capital,” added Chief Architect of Moscow.

As it is already known, in Khorokhyovo-Mnevniki , it is planned to build two bicycle bridges on Ostrovnaya Street and towards Fili Park, and two more automobile bridges on Novozavodskaya and Myasishchev streets. In addition, an automobile bridge will be constructed at the alignments of Beregovoy and Prichalny passages. Pedestrian bridges will also be built in the areas of Nagatinsky Backwater and Yakimanka.
